Essential Preparation Before Getting the Killmonger Haircut
Before you get the Killmonger hairstyle, you need to prepare your hair. You must understand what the style needs. And make sure your hair is ready for the change.
Required Hair Length and Growth Timeline
The Killmonger style needs hair that’s long enough for dreadlocks. You’ll have to grow your hair for months. It takes about 6-12 months, depending on how fast your hair grows.
Pre-Styling Hair Care Routine
While growing your hair, keep it healthy. Wash it gently with shampoo. Use conditioner to keep it moist. And avoid using too much heat to prevent damage.
Finding the Right Barber or Stylist
When your hair is long enough, find a pro who knows dreadlocks. Look for someone with experience in dreadlocks. They can help you get the real Killmonger look and teach you how to care for it.

Daily Maintenance and Styling Routine
Keeping your Killmonger hairstyle looking great every day is key. A routine helps you rock this look with confidence.
Morning Refresh Techniques
Begin by gently washing your dreads with a special spray or shampoo. Use a soft towel to dry them. Then, apply a leave-in conditioner or wax to keep your locs soft and neat.
Nighttime Protection Methods
At night, cover your Killmonger hairstyle with a satin or silk scarf. This stops frizz and breakage. Also, use a satin pillowcase for extra care.
Quick Fixes for On-the-Go Styling
For a quick fix, use a gel or wax to shape your locs. Carry moisturizer or hair oil to keep your scalp moist. These Killmonger hairstyle ideas keep you looking fresh.
